Your eSIM Trails plan's validity period (e.g., 7 days or 30 days) begins precisely when your eSIM successfully connects to a local mobile network in your destination country. This means you have the flexibility to purchase and install your eSIM well in advance of your trip. Whether you're planning weeks ahead or just days, your data plan won't start ticking down until you've physically arrived and your device registers with a network, ensuring you get full value for your adventure.
